Lemon Blueberry Sheet Cake is a refreshing dessert that perfectly balances the zesty brightness of lemons with the sweetness of juicy blueberries. Ideal for summer gatherings, picnics, or simply as a delightful treat at home, this cake is easy to prepare and yields generous portions for sharing. Topped with a smooth lemon glaze, it’s not only visually appealing but also incredibly delicious. With just 20 minutes of prep time and simple steps, you’ll have a moist and flavorful cake that will impress your family and friends.
Ingredients
- 3 cups all-purpose flour
- 2 teaspoons baking powder
- 1/2 teaspoon baking soda
- 1 1/4 teaspoon salt
- 1 cup butter (2 sticks), softened
- 1 1/2 cups granulated sugar
- Juice and zest of 2 lemons (about 1/4 cup lemon juice)
- 4 large eggs
- 1 cup buttermilk
- 2 teaspoons vanilla extract
- 1 1/2 cups fresh blueberries, tossed with 1 Tbs flour
- 2 1/2 cups powdered sugar
- 1/3 cup lemon juice
Instructions
- Preheat the oven to 350°F. Grease a 9×13 baking dish and line it with parchment paper.
- In a bowl, whisk together flour, baking powder, baking soda, and salt.
- Cream together butter and sugar until fluffy. Add eggs, vanilla, and buttermilk until smooth.
- Gradually mix in dry ingredients until fully combined. Gently fold in lemon juice, zest, and blueberries.
- Pour batter into the prepared dish and bake for 40–45 minutes or until a toothpick comes out clean.
- Once cooled, prepare the glaze by mixing powdered sugar with lemon juice and pour over the cake.
- Prep Time: 20 minutes
- Cook Time: 40–45 minutes
